0001-Build-failure-when-cross-building-for-64-bit-ARM-htt.patch 1.1 KB

1234567891011121314151617181920212223242526272829303132
  1. From b0c63502f004db68b485354967bb1c56c071f4eb Mon Sep 17 00:00:00 2001
  2. From: Adrian Perez de Castro <aperez@igalia.com>
  3. Date: Tue, 31 May 2022 00:48:21 +0300
  4. Subject: [PATCH] Build failure when cross-building for 64-bit ARM
  5. https://bugs.webkit.org/show_bug.cgi?id=241109
  6. Unreviewed build fix.
  7. * Source/WebCore/bindings/js/JSDOMMapLike.cpp: Add missing
  8. JavaScriptCore/HashMapImplInlines.h header inclusion.
  9. Signed-off-by: Adrian Perez de Castro <aperez@igalia.com>
  10. Upstream status: https://github.com/WebKit/WebKit/pull/1165
  11. ---
  12. Source/WebCore/bindings/js/JSDOMMapLike.cpp | 1 +
  13. 1 file changed, 1 insertion(+)
  14. diff --git a/Source/WebCore/bindings/js/JSDOMMapLike.cpp b/Source/WebCore/bindings/js/JSDOMMapLike.cpp
  15. index e132c39fa54..2cb4b1b59a3 100644
  16. --- a/Source/WebCore/bindings/js/JSDOMMapLike.cpp
  17. +++ b/Source/WebCore/bindings/js/JSDOMMapLike.cpp
  18. @@ -28,6 +28,7 @@
  19. #include "WebCoreJSClientData.h"
  20. #include <JavaScriptCore/CatchScope.h>
  21. +#include <JavaScriptCore/HashMapImplInlines.h>
  22. #include <JavaScriptCore/JSMap.h>
  23. #include <JavaScriptCore/VMTrapsInlines.h>
  24. --
  25. 2.36.1